Summary:
The Decatur County Community Schools district in Indiana is home to two elementary schools: North Decatur Elementary School and South Decatur Elementary School. These schools serve students from pre-kindergarten through 6th grade in the Decatur County area.
Based on the available data, North Decatur Elementary School appears to be the standout performer in the district. The school has consistently ranked higher in the statewide SchoolDigger rankings, with a ranking of 163 out of 1,005 Indiana elementary schools for the 2024-2025 school year, compared to South Decatur's ranking of 488. Additionally, North Decatur Elementary School outperforms South Decatur Elementary School and the overall district in proficiency rates across various ILEARN assessments, including English Language Arts, Math, Science, and Social Studies.
While both schools face challenges, such as high chronic absenteeism rates, the data suggests potential equity concerns within the district. The significant difference in free and reduced-price lunch rates between the two schools (48.12% at North Decatur vs. 62.33% at South Decatur) indicates that South Decatur Elementary School serves a higher proportion of economically disadvantaged students. This disparity warrants further investigation and targeted interventions to ensure equitable access to educational opportunities for all students in the Decatur County Community Schools district.
